Salvation Army Leader’s Visit
(N.Z. Press Association) WELLINGTON, Feb. 21. The Salvation Army’s international leader, General Wilfrid Hitching, accompanied by Mrs Kitehing, will arrive in Wellington on March 14 to j preside at the eightieth anniversary of the Army’s congress. Other overseas visitors include Lieutenant-Colonel Bernard Watson, editor of a London youth magazine, and listing Chang from Korea who is. to study theology in j New Zealand.
